DRAFT Ver. 1-C-doc-4-5-10 <br />Page 18 Tier II Qualified Facility SPCC Plan <br />Table G-19 General Rule Requirements for Onshore Oil Production Facilities N/A <br />All aboveground valves and piping associated with transfer operations are inspected periodically and <br />upon a regular schedule. The general condition of flange joints, valve glands and bodies, drip pans, pipe <br />supports, pumping well polish rod stuffing boxes, bleeder and gauge valves, and other such items are <br />included in the inspection.[See Inspection Log and Schedule in Attachment 3.1][§112.9(d)(1)] <br />An oil spill contingency plan and written commitment of resources are provided for flowlines and intra- <br />facility gathering lines [See Oil Spill Contingency Plan and Checklist in Attachment 2 and Inspection <br />Log and Schedule in Attachment 3.1][§112.9(d)(3)] <br />or <br />Appropriate secondary containment and/or diversionary structures or equipment is provided for flowlines <br />and intra-facility gathering lines to prevent a discharge to navigable waters or adjoining shorelines. The <br />entire secondary containment system, including walls and floor, is capable of containing oil and is <br />constructed so that any discharge from the pipe, will not escape the containment system before cleanup <br />occurs. <br />A flowline/intra-facility gathering line maintenance program to prevent discharges from each flowline has <br />been established at this facility. The maintenance program addresses each of the following: <br />x Flowlines and intra-facility gathering lines and associated valves and equipment are compatible <br />with the type of production fluids, their potential corrosivity, volume, and pressure, and other <br />conditions expected in the operational environment; <br />x Flowlines, intra-facility gathering lines and associated appurtenances are visually inspected <br />and/or tested on a periodic and regular schedule for leaks, oil discharges, corrosion, or other <br />conditions that could lead to a discharge as described in §112.1(b).
